About

Great Witchingham ward encompasses several rural parishes in the Broadland district. The landscape is characterised by agricultural land, small woodland areas, and the meandering course of the River Wensum. Settlement is primarily in scattered villages and hamlets, with traditional buildings including the notable church of St. Mary at Great Witchingham.

The area's economy has long been connected to farming and estate management. A private wildlife park, housing species like white rhinos and giraffes, operates within the ward's boundaries, representing a significant local attraction. The rural lanes and public footpaths provide access to the quiet, working countryside.

Area overview

On average Great Witchingham has moderate de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 25 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 6.7%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Great Witchingham is £51,323 per year. There are 1 schools in Great Witchingham: 1 primary (0 Outstanding and 1 Good) and 0 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good). Great Witchingham is home to around 2,717 people, with a population density of about 37.5 per km2.

Property prices in Great Witchingham

Based on 22 recent sales, the median property price is £435,000 in Great Witchingham area, with individual transactions ranging from £167,600 up to £2,800,000.
